About Our Service... Hestia provides support for offenders and ex-offenders across London through our criminal justice services.

For more than 50 years, Hestia's criminal justice services have focused on recovery and rehabilitation, providing accommodation and support to those whose who need it.

Our criminal justice service recognises the impact of trauma on those who commit crimes. Regardless of the cause of this distress, we adopt the same trauma-informed approach in our offender services as we do across our organisation.

You will be working alongside a specialist staff team who assist individuals by offering practical support to enable them to live independently.
